Abstract

The invention discloses a kind of novel inflating lids, including attachment base ontology, attachment base ontology upper and lower opening and under shed are used to connect with container finish, attachment base ontology upper opening is raised up to the diaphragm of inflating for being connected with elastically deformable, it inflates diaphragm and attachment base ontology is formed with and inflates chamber, the outlet tube being connected to attachment base ontology under shed is additionally provided on attachment base ontology, outlet tube upper end stretches out in attachment base ontology and is equipped with the closeouts for sealing outlet tube upper port, diaphragm of inflating is equipped with so that outside air, which can enter, inflates the indoor gas supplementary structure of chamber, filling carbonated beverage is particularly suitable for using container of the invention, so as in the case where Kaifeng has been not used, gas is filled with into container by inflating lid, guarantee the air pressure level in container, so that it is guaranteed that preservation quality;In addition, constantly being inflated by inflating lid, the solution in container can accordingly be extruded, there is the characteristics of simple for structure, manufacturing cost is low and is convenient for people to use.

[specific embodiment]
It elaborates with reference to the accompanying drawing to embodiments of the present invention.
As shown in figs. 1-7, a kind of novel inflating lid of the present invention, including attachment base ontology 1, about the 1 attachment base ontology Opening and under shed with container finish for connect, 1 upper opening of attachment base ontology are raised up to that be connected with can elasticity shape What is become inflates diaphragm 11, and diaphragm of inflating can integrally connect with attachment base ontology, described to inflate diaphragm 11 and attachment base ontology 1 is formed Inflate chamber 15, be additionally provided with the outlet tube 12 being connected to 1 under shed of attachment base ontology on the attachment base ontology 1, it is described go out 12 upper end of liquid pipe stretches out in attachment base ontology 1 and is equipped with the closeouts 13 for sealing 12 upper port of outlet tube, described to inflate Diaphragm 11 is equipped with so that outside air can enter the gas supplementary structure 14 inflated in chamber 15.Diaphragm of inflating is located at attachment base ontology Upper opening, and be made due to inflating diaphragm of the material of elastically deformable, corresponding gas supplementary structure is set inflating on diaphragm, is made Used time, directly diaphragm is inflated in effect to inflate to the container being attached thereto, and outside air can run through tonifying Qi knot Structure is to tonifying Qi in chamber is inflated, and not only easy to use, tonifying Qi is efficient, and simple for structure, and manufacturing cost is lower.
As seen in figs. 5-6, the closeouts 13 are that check valve flow out solution can uniaxially from outlet tube 12, are used When, when the solution pressure in container is greater than the threshold value of the check valve, which is then washed open by solution.
Picture 1-4 and shown in Fig. 7, the closeouts 13 be plug, the plug by thin position removably with outlet tube 12 Upper port connection.In use, existing fracture the plug removal from outlet tube upper port, at this time outlet tube upper port then with extraneous company It is logical.
As shown in Figs. 1-2, the gas supplementary structure 14 is tonifying Qi through-hole, in use, user blocks the tonifying Qi through-hole with hand It presses inward against and inflates diaphragm and be allowed to flexible deformation, then enter container intracavity positioned at the indoor air of chamber is inflated, when user's hand When release, tonifying Qi through-hole is then opened wide, and outside air inflates chamber inflating in diaphragm reseting procedure to be rapidly entered by tonifying Qi through-hole It is interior, repeatedly, then complete pumping action.
As shown in figure 3, the gas supplementary structure 14 is that can make outside air that can enter the designated port inflated in chamber 15, due to Diaphragm itself of inflating has an elastic deformation performance, therefore the designated port is then formed in and inflates membrane flexive deformation and compress when inflating chamber The one-way valve structures that can be closed automatically, and when inflate diaphragm reset when, outside air can by the designated port enter inflate in chamber.
As seen in figs. 5-6, the gas supplementary structure 14 is exhaust valve, and it is up and down which opposite can inflate diaphragm, is made Used time, user push down the spool of exhaust valve with hand and make to inflate membrane flexive to deform, positioned at inflate the indoor air of chamber then into Enter container intracavity, resetted when inflating diaphragm, when user has pulled the spool of exhaust valve, outside air was resetted inflating diaphragm Then exhaust valve is inflated in chamber by rapidly entering in journey, repeatedly, then complete pumping action.
As shown in Fig. 4,7, for the diaphragm 11 of inflating equipped with recessed portion 16, the gas supplementary structure 14 is to be located on recessed portion 16 So that outside air is unidirectionally entered the designated port inflated in chamber 15.There is elastic deformation performance due to inflating diaphragm itself, therefore The designated port, which is then formed in, inflates membrane flexive deformation and compresses the one-way valve structures that can be closed automatically when inflating chamber, and works as and inflate When diaphragm resets, it can be entered from the designated port more rapidly by design recessed portion outside air and be inflated in chamber.
As shown in fig. 7, it is described inflate be equipped in chamber 15 will inflate chamber 15 and 1 under shed of attachment base ontology separates every Spacer 17 is run through in set 17,12 lower end of outlet tube, the spacer 17 be equipped with can make the air inflated in chamber 15 unidirectionally into The check valve for entering 1 under shed of attachment base ontology, by the design structure, chamber 15 of inflating then form the space of relative closure and with Container intracavity separates, and the solution for being more advantageous to container intracavity is guaranteed the quality and inflated out liquid.
As seen in figures 8-14, a kind of novel inflating lid of the present invention, including attachment base ontology 1 and removable cover 2, the attachment base 1 upper and lower opening of ontology and under shed are used to connect with container finish, and the removable cover 2 is movably connected in attachment base ontology 1 Upper opening is equipped between the removable cover 2 and attachment base ontology 1 for matching removable cover 2 with 1 slidable sealing of attachment base ontology The piston ring 18 of conjunction is equipped in the attachment base ontology 1 and separates 1 upper opening of attachment base ontology and under shed and lacerable Diaphragm seal 3 is formed between the removable cover 2 and attachment base ontology 1 and inflates chamber 15.Diaphragm seal primarily serves anti-fake work of guaranteeing the quality With in use, first separating removable cover with attachment base ontology, and then diaphragm seal being torn, removable cover is being reinstalled later, by anti- Removable cover is acted on again, and when removable cover resets upwards, outside air can be entered by piston ring inflate chamber.
For quick tonifying Qi, the removable cover 2 is equipped with gas supplementary structure 14, and as illustrated in figs. 8-12, which can Think tonifying Qi through-hole, is also possible to be located on removable cover and making outside air can be unidirectionally into inflating the indoor check valve of chamber.
Liquid is inflated out in order to realize, as seen in figs. 8-10, lower end and attachment base ontology is equipped on the attachment base ontology 1 The connection of 1 under shed and upper end stretch out in the outlet tube 12 of attachment base ontology 1.
In order to seal at the beginning, as Figure 8-9, closeouts 13, the closure are equipped in 12 upper port of outlet tube Part is broken plug.
As illustrated in figs. 11-14, the mode of liquid is inflated out as another kind, liquid outlet 21 is equipped on the removable cover 2, Disk when inflating initial in chamber 15 is placed with soft catheter 22, soft catheter 22 and liquid outlet after diaphragm seal 3 is torn 21 inner ports connect and container intracavity is protruded into 22 lower end of soft catheter.When diaphragm seal do not tear it is initial when, soft catheter Then disk, which is placed on, inflates in chamber, when tearing diaphragm seal in use, soft catheter is connect with liquid outlet, soft catheter Lower end is being protruded into container, therefore has smart structural design, flexible feature easy to use, therefore facilitates assembling and packaging fortune It is defeated.
As shown in figure 13, be equipped in the attachment base ontology 1 by 1 upper opening of attachment base ontology and under shed separate every Block 4, lacerable diaphragm seal 3 are located on spacer block 4, and the spacer block 4 is equipped with to can be when chamber 15 is inflated in the compression of removable cover 2 and beat Air in gas chamber 15 unidirectionally enters the check valve of 1 under shed of attachment base ontology.When tearing diaphragm seal is in use, will be soft Catheter is connect with liquid outlet, and the lower end of soft catheter is being protruded into container, is connect between soft catheter and spacer block for sealing Touching connection, therefore inflate chamber 15 and be a confined space and be spaced, be more conducive to inflate pressure maintaining and inflate out with container intracavity Liquid.
As shown in Figure 15-24, a kind of novel inflating lid of the present invention, including attachment base ontology 1 and removable cover 2, the connection Seat 1 upper and lower opening of ontology and under shed are used to connect with container finish, and the removable cover 2 is movably connected in attachment base ontology 1 upper opening is equipped between the removable cover 2 and attachment base ontology 1 for making removable cover 2 and 1 slidable sealing of attachment base ontology The piston ring 18 of cooperation is equipped in the attachment base ontology 11 under shed of attachment base ontology being equipped with spacer block 4, the removable cover 2, It is formed between attachment base ontology 1 and spacer block 4 and inflates chamber 15, the spacer block 4 is equipped with when chamber 15 is inflated in the compression of removable cover 2 When can be the check valve that the air inflated in chamber 15 unidirectionally enters 1 under shed of attachment base ontology, 1 top of attachment base ontology Outside is equipped with connection external screw thread 19, and 2 top of removable cover, which is bent downward, is formed with connection flange 23, in the connection flange 23 Side is equipped with connection internal screw thread 231, when original state, connection flange 23 by connection external screw thread 19 with connect the cooperation of internal screw thread 231 Connection.Due to it is initial when, removable cover and attachment base ontology can be can avoid by connection external screw thread and connection internal screw thread connection In transportational process removable cover with respect to attachment base ontology generate relative motion, while enable inflating lid at the beginning or it is unused when Volume is reduced, in order to store and transport.
To avoid inflating lid from maliciously being opened, on the attachment base ontology 1 be equipped with original state when with connect flange 23 The anti-theft ring 24 of tearable connection, as shown in Figure 15-18 and Figure 21-22;It as needed, can also be on the connection flange 23 The anti-theft ring 24 being connect when equipped with original state with 1 tearable of attachment base ontology, as shown in Figure 19-20 and Figure 23-24.
It automatically resets after being pressed for the ease of removable cover, to reach laborsaving convenient feature, in the chamber 15 of inflating It is interior to be equipped with the elastic component 25 resetted for removable cover 2.As shown in Figure 17-18, the elastic component 25 is spring leaf, the spring leaf Upper end connect with removable cover 2, and the lower end of the spring leaf contacts at and inflates 15 bottom of chamber.
The attachment base ontology 1 is equipped with and is connected to 1 under shed of attachment base ontology and upper end stretches out in attachment base ontology 1 Outlet tube 12,12 upper port of outlet tube are equipped with closeouts 13.As shown in Figure 21,22, closeouts 13 are broken plug, In use, existing fracture plug, so that 12 upper port of outlet tube is opened wide, repeated action removable cover, the chamber that will inflate are indoor later Air is pressed into container intracavity, and the solution of container intracavity is then accordingly flowed out from outlet tube.
As shown in figure 23 and figure 24, on the spacer block 4 and the check valve on spacer block 4 is circumferentially upwardly extended to be formed with and be inflated Pipe 41, be additionally provided on the spacer block 4 can with inflate the liquid inlet conduit 42 that chamber 15 is connected to, the liquid inlet conduit 42, which is equipped with, to be made The solution for obtaining container intracavity unidirectionally enters the check valve inflated in chamber 15.In use, repeated action removable cover, chamber will be inflated Interior air is pressed into container intracavity by air-inflating tube 41, when the pressure of container intracavity is greater than the threshold of the check valve in liquid inlet conduit 42 When value, the solution of container intracavity, which then accordingly enters, inflates in chamber 15 and carries out liquid storage, and when reaching respective volume, user is beaten After opening removable cover, then storage can be poured out in the solution inflated in chamber 15.
To sum up, inflating lid of the present invention is not limited to use in the container of filling carbonated beverage, also includes other containers.
